Output 64fcca4e94ef1603024115661de4db9eff507de70d64462061f65809027772e1:0

value
2001569
script pubkey
OP_0 OP_PUSHBYTES_20 c3b99a46d42e0782769b343f3dcefd707217659f
address
bc1qcwue53k59crcya5mxslnmnhawpepwevl2ztch9
transaction
64fcca4e94ef1603024115661de4db9eff507de70d64462061f65809027772e1
confirmations
222411
spent
true